# Heads up: the LockerLoop access flow for the laundry lockers is weirder
# than it looks. The kiosk pings the reservation service first, then falls
# back to cached badge scans if Wi-Fi drops in the basement at the Fernwick
# building. Don't reorder these settings or fallback breaks. The reservation
# lookups hit the primary store using the connection string below.

primary connection of tajeg-tajop = postgresql://julax_svc:DI@db-e7f3.kelvidyn.corp:5432/rusdor

This fragment covers the pre-release checks for the Almsgate donation-receipt mailer. Before promoting a build, confirm the nightly batch from the Coffertide ledger completed without skipped rows, then verify the template renderer passed the golden-file suite — a single mismatched receipt line has regulatory implications, so do not waive failures. Queue depth must be below 500 before cut-over; drain if necessary. Once those gates pass, apply the release configuration exactly as recorded below, making no manual substitutions:

deployment values, kajep-kageg:
[praix]
host = praix.paliqcorp.corp
user = praix_svc
database = praix_prod

Prepared for the incoming director, Halverton Consumer Group. The proposed 18% reduction to the marketing budget affects primarily the Brightmoor campaign and regional sponsorships; digital acquisition spend is protected. We modelled three scenarios, and the middle case preserves lead volume at roughly 91% of current levels. The team is understandably anxious, so sequencing of the announcement matters. Procurement commitments through Q2 are already locked. The reduction connects directly to a broader plan, summarised below for your review.

confidential, yagag-tajof: Only 3 of the 120 pilot accounts renewed Holwyn, so a churn review is set for April 15.